Retinal ganglion cell neuronal damage in diabetes and diabetic retinopathy

Abstract
Background: To examine the association of diabetes and diabetic retinopathy (DR) with retinal ganglion cell (RGC) loss. Design: Observational case–control study. Participants: Type 2 diabetes cases and age-gender matched controls without diabetes. Methods: Spectral-domain optical coherence tomography (OCT) parameters of RGCs were calculated after automated segmentation of macular scans. DR severity was graded on fundus photographs using the modified Airlie House Classification system. Generalized estimating equation was used to compare OCT parameters between cases and controls, adjusted for covariates.
